Gwyl Haf Summer Festival Line Up Announced!

We have just announced our line up for Gwyl Haf Summer Fest with all proceeds going to Wales Air Ambulance! This year is all about supporting local artists and the best electronic music talent South Wales can offer!

Robot Monkey will be supported by:

Runo B (Spiral Brothers) - a Frenchman by background and Cardiff based, he has been DJing for 12yrs as one half of the Spiral Brothers, not unfamiliar to the festival scene having played discerning festivals such as Glastonbury. Described as world music specialist, he takes his audience on a journey of world trancy funk! Be prepared to be dazzled!

Cellan Eynon - Originally a Swansea boy, Cellan is currently studying Electronic Music Production at dBs Music in Bristol. He plays a nice groovy deep and tech house vibe and is looking forward to entertaining the West Wales crowd at Gwyl Haf. Expect energetic summer vibes from him to tap your feet to or have right old carry on!

John Garbutt - John is a Cardiff based DJ who?s DJ career has taken him on a journey through the deeper sounds of techno. At his Gwyl Haf set, John will play a number of new late night tracks with some proper classics thrown into the mix. Back playing electronic music and sharing it with people is what its about from Tresor to LFO. Look forward to seeing you all at the dance!
